What is remote human resource management teaching?

Remote human resource management teaching involves instructing students or professionals in the principles and practices of HR management through online platforms. Educators deliver courses, workshops, or training sessions via video conferencing, learning management systems, or other digital tools. This role typically covers topics like recruitment, employee relations, compensation, and organizational behavior, all taught in a virtual environment. Remote HR instructors must be adept at using technology to foster engagement and ensure effective learning outcomes.

What are some common challenges faced when teaching human resource management remotely, and how can they be addressed?

Teaching Human Resource Management remotely often presents challenges such as maintaining student engagement, facilitating interactive discussions, and ensuring practical application of HR concepts. To overcome these, instructors can use a mix of synchronous and asynchronous tools, incorporate real-life case studies, and encourage group projects through collaborative platforms. Regular feedback, virtual office hours, and interactive simulations also help foster a dynamic learning environment and bridge the gap between theory and practice.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a remote human resource management teacher,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ote Human Resource Management Teacher, you need expertise in HR principles, a relevant degree (often a master's), and teaching or training experience. Familiarity with virtual learning platforms, course management systems like Moodle or Canvas, and possibly HR certifications (e.g., SHRM-CP or PHR) is typical. Outstanding communication, adaptability, and the ability to engage and motivate remote learners are crucial soft skills. These competencies ensure effective knowledge transfer, student engagement, and successful online learning outcomes in a virtual environment.

What is the difference between Remote Human Resource Management Teaching vs Remote HR Coordinator?

AspectRemote Human Resource Management TeachingRemote HR Coordinator
Required CredentialsHR certifications, teaching credentials, or related degreesHR certifications, administrative experience
Work EnvironmentOnline classrooms, training platformsRemote office, communication tools
Employer & Industry UsageEducational institutions, online training providersCorporations, HR departments, staffing agencies
Search & Comparison IntentTeaching roles, HR education, online HR trainingHR support, coordination, employee relations

Remote Human Resource Management Teaching focuses on educating students or professionals about HR principles through online platforms, often requiring teaching credentials. In contrast, Remote HR Coordinators handle administrative HR tasks, employee communication, and support within organizations. Both roles involve HR knowledge but differ in responsibilities, work environment, and required qualifications.
